  • Airlines eye Asian growth through JAL

    September 15, 2009

    AIR FRANCE -KLM is understood to be in talks to invest in Japan Airlines, joining a list of suitors seeking a stake in the loss-making carrier to access its route network. Delta Air Lines and American Airlines are also believed to be in separate talks with JAL, Asia’s biggest carrier by revenue. Each airline is [...]

  • Deutsche kicks off charity fund

    September 15, 2009

    DEUTSCHE Bank has become the first investor in a new venture philanthropy fund to tackle poverty in London. The London Fund, set to be managed by venture philanthropy firm Impetus Trust, is now calling for investment from other City firms to boost its initial value of £1.3m.   • Ofcom lifts rules on BT sales

    September 15, 2009

    OFCOM said yesterday that it will remove the last piece of regulation that has prevented BT from selling discounted fixed-line voice, broadband and TV packages. Other network providers – such as Virgin Media, BSkyB and Carphone Warehouse’s TalkTalk – are already able to offer reduced rates to customers who take more than one of their [...]

  • Watchdog says that ITV contract rules must stay

    September 15, 2009

    THE COMPETITION Commission said yesterday that rules governing how ITV charges advertisers cannot be removed, but could be adapted for the changing market. The contract rights renewal (CRR) system links advertising prices to viewing figures and was introduced in 2003 when ITV formed from a merger of Granada and Carlton. ITV has campaigned to have [...]

  • 1,100 jobs to go at defence colossus BAE

    September 15, 2009

    DEFENCE giant BAE Systems is to axe 1,100 jobs and close an aircraft factory in Cheshire, it emerged yesterday. The group said it planned to close its Woodford, Cheshire plant at the end of 2012 with the loss of 630 jobs. Other jobs will go at various sites across the country, including in Farnborough.
